**Title: Unleashing Terror: A Dive into “High Tension” (2003)**
“High Tension,” directed by Alexandre Aja, is a French slasher film that captivates audiences with its relentless intensity and graphic violence. The narrative follows two friends, Marie and Alex, who seek a peaceful retreat in the countryside, only to face a horrifying nightmare when a masked killer invades Alex’s family home, brutally murdering her relatives. As Marie and Alex attempt to escape, they are thrust into a relentless chase that tests their limits of survival.
The film is notable for its shocking twists and unyielding suspense, keeping viewers engaged and anxious throughout. Aja’s direction effectively creates an atmosphere of dread, utilizing tight cinematography that immerses the audience in moments of terror and vulnerability. The performances by Cécile de France and Maïwenn add depth to the characters, enhancing the emotional stakes as Marie desperately tries to save her friend.
“High Tension” stands out in the horror genre for its ability to blend psychological horror with visceral violence, culminating in a bloody climax that leaves a lasting impact. Its masterful pacing and unexpected revelations make it a memorable entry that pushes the boundaries of fear and suspense.
